do you mean ROAR approved?

If so, currently, the 36, 37 and 38's are too large in sub-c specification size and the membership is being asked in this next election to approve or not approve changing the ruling to allow up to 44mm in length of the cells. Currently, ROAR allows 43mm as the longest cell length but IFMAR has approved 44mm to allow the higher than 3300's in competition.

Currently, only 3300's are approved for ROAR competition but several 36 through 38's have been submitted and are awaiting membership vote as to the change in sub-c cell size. Of course, this will effect the chassis manufacturers as well.


I only hope the membership votes this election and offers their thought to the sub-c cell specification needs and the long term effects.
